Needle Arm and Needle Assembly
1.
Using a flat-blade screwdriver (turn counter-clockwise
ONLY), slightly lower the needle arm to make room for
using the wrench in Step 4.
2.
Unsrew the PEEK nut at the top of the needle assembly
and remove the protective cap from needle tip.
3.
Position the needle into the arm, lowering the tip
through the lower mount block, and pushing the top of
the assembly upware and into the upper mount block.
4.
Secure with the nut (placed over the washer), and
tighten with 1/2" open-end wrench. Be careful NOT to
over-tighten the nut.
5.
Screw the PEEK nut (with the sample tubing attached)
back into the threaded mount of the needle assembly
until it is finger tight. DO NOT over-tighten the nut.
6.
Using a flat-blade screwdriver, raise the arm back into
place.

1.
Connect the GE Autosampler to the Analyzer using the
provided USB-to-Serial cable.
2.
Connect the Analyzer to a network using a straight-thru
Ethernet cable or directly to a computer using a cross-
over Ethernet cable.
3.
Insert the power cord into the GE Autosampler and then
connect to a grounded power outlet.
